Table 4

Fourier series of the oscillations in the τ angle of Phobos with respect to the ESAPHO reference frame.

Notes. The lower bound amplitude of 0.0014 deg corresponds to a displacement of 0.32 m at the surface of Phobos by taking the longest radius equal to 13.0 km. The series are in sine.
